What is a spokesperson?

By Marianne Mitsui

Every company is subjected to intense media exposure, surrounded by different types of media outlets. To learn how to handle the press properly, organizations need a spokesperson speaking for them in order to transmit appropriate and honest messages. The spokesperson is a skilled professional able to explain clearly complex issues and therefore to attend the media more effectively.

The spokesperson understand the functioning of the entire journalistic process, knows how to behave in front of cameras in interviews or events and recognizes the importance of the media and the press relations. It is very important that those professionals go through a media training so that they can be prepared for dealing with the press.

Media training is a key strategy for the press relations agency before executing actions. The training is applied in different ways, either through workshops, lectures or interviews simulation.
